A 28-foot ladder is placed against a building. The bottom of the ladder is 3 feet from the building. If the top of the ladder slips down 4 feet, how far will the bottom of the ladder be from the bottom of the building? Round to the hundredths

Explanation:

Using Pythagorean theorem, the initial vertical distance of top of ladder from the bottom

#=\sqrt{28^2-3^2}#

#=5\sqrt31#

When top slids down by #4# feet from initial position then new vertical distance of top of ladder from the bottom will

#5\sqrt31-4#

Now, using Pythagorean theorem, the distance of bottom of latter from the building

#=\sqrt{28^2-(5\sqrt31-4)^2}#

#=14.687#

The distance of bottom of ladder from the building will be #14.687# feet
